Web3 Gaming: A Promise Unfulfilled for Players and Developers

Small Cap Bulls Editorial Team by Small Cap Bulls Editorial Team
July 10, 2025
Reading Time: 10 mins read
0
Web3 Gaming: A Promise Unfulfilled for Players and Developers

Web3 gaming is set to redefine the gaming landscape by leveraging blockchain technology to offer players a new level of ownership and engagement. As the gaming industry faces ongoing challenges, including rising development costs and a mounting innovation crisis, Web3 technology emerges as a beacon of hope, promising to return power to developers and players alike. Despite significant investment and the allure of NFT games, mainstream adoption remains elusive, with many potential players bewildered by the complexities of crypto gaming. This disconnect highlights a critical pivot in the gaming industry trends, where the focus must shift back to crafting enjoyable experiences over mere tokenomics. Ultimately, the future of Web3 gaming hinges on balancing profitable models with engaging content that resonates with gamers.

The rise of decentralized gaming platforms encapsulates a profound shift within the interactive entertainment sector, often termed ‘on-chain gaming’ or ‘blockchain-based games.’ These innovative platforms strive to grant players true ownership of in-game assets, a promise that has captivated attention amid the game’s traditional confines. However, while the enthusiasm for crypto assets is palpable, many within the gaming community remain doubtful about the overall experience offered by NFT-supported ventures. As the current paradigm of video game development struggles with escalating budgets and market oversaturation, this evolution towards gaming integration with cryptocurrencies presents a pivotal chance for transformation. The future of the industry rests on the ability to foster creativity and user engagement beyond mere financial incentives.

 

The Rise and Challenges of Web3 Gaming

Web3 gaming has emerged as a potential game-changer within the blockchain gaming industry, offering an array of new opportunities for developers and players alike. However, the journey has been nothing short of tumultuous. Despite significant investments aimed at transforming the gaming landscape through Web3 technology, the anticipated mainstream adoption has largely eluded the space. The promise of blockchain’s decentralized nature and the potential for creating engaging and immersive gaming experiences remains unfulfilled, leading to skepticism about its viability as a sustainable gaming model.

One of the most pressing issues faced by Web3 gaming is the failure to address the fundamental shortcomings that plague traditional gaming. High development costs, lack of connectivity, and poor player experiences have become pervasive. Many developers, in their pursuit of control and funding, have inadvertently recreated the walled ecosystems they aimed to dismantle. This reluctance to innovate beyond tokenomics and financial incentives has kept mainstream gamers at bay, ultimately hindering growth and limiting the sector to a niche audience of crypto enthusiasts.

NFT Games and Their Impact on Player Engagement

NFT games have introduced a new dimension to player interaction within the gaming ecosystem. The ability to own unique in-game items has changed the landscape, creating a sense of investment and personal connection to the game. However, this model often emphasizes financial participation over genuine gameplay experience. While the trading of NFTs can provide revenue opportunities for developers, it also risks alienating players who prefer simply enjoying the game without the added pressure of commodifying their experience.

Furthermore, the focus on NFT trading can unintentionally detract from the overall game mechanics and narratives. Developers may prioritize creating attractive NFT assets that generate revenue rather than building rich, engaging storylines or gameplay elements. As a result, while NFT games promise ownership and potential profits, they may fall short in providing the engaging experiences that players have come to expect from traditional gaming.

Overcoming Challenges in Gaming Development Costs

The steep development costs involved in traditional gaming have often limited creativity and innovation. Unless studios can secure significant funding, many ideas may never come to fruition, stifling the potential for revolutionary gaming experiences. Web3 gaming, in theory, should alleviate some of these costs through new fundraising models and decentralized financing options. However, the outcomes have often replicated the issues of traditional funding systems, with platforms favouring a select few projects over others.

Addressing the financial burdens that developers face requires innovative approaches that prioritize inclusivity and equal opportunity. Collaborative platforms where indie developers can pitch to a community-driven audience or utilize decentralized funding mechanisms can change the financial landscape. By easing these pressure points, Web3 gaming can create a more vibrant ecosystem where unique ideas can flourish unimpeded by traditional financial structures.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Web3 gaming and how does it differ from traditional gaming?

Web3 gaming refers to games that leverage blockchain technology to enhance player ownership and engagement through decentralized platforms. Unlike traditional gaming, which is often controlled by publishers, Web3 gaming aims to empower developers and players with true ownership of in-game assets, facilitated by smart contracts and NFTs.

How do NFTs fit into the Web3 gaming landscape?

Non-fungible tokens (NFTs) are integral to Web3 gaming, as they allow players to own unique in-game assets that can be traded or sold on various marketplaces. This concept of ownership is meant to create a stronger incentive for players to engage with games, as they can truly own and monetize their gaming experiences.

What are the current challenges facing the Web3 gaming industry?

The Web3 gaming industry faces several challenges, including high player acquisition costs, poor user experience due to reliance on existing blockchains, and the failure to attract mainstream gamers. Also, many Web3 games prioritize tokenomics over gameplay, which detracts from the fun and engaging experiences players desire.

Are there any notable trends in the Web3 gaming industry today?

Current trends in the Web3 gaming industry include increased investment in blockchain gaming projects, efforts to create more user-friendly experiences, and collaborations between traditional game developers and Web3 technology. Additionally, there’s a growing focus on making games fun and engaging rather than primarily driven by crypto incentives.

Why havenโ€™t mainstream players embraced Web3 gaming?

Despite rising interest in crypto, mainstream players have not fully embraced Web3 gaming due to concerns over gameplay quality, high costs, and an overwhelming focus on tokenomics rather than delivering enjoyable experiences. Many players are more interested in meaningful ownership of assets rather than the financial aspects of gaming.

What steps can developers take to improve Web3 gaming experiences?

To enhance Web3 gaming, developers should prioritize building games that are fun and engaging first, followed by incorporating Web3 elements like ownership and decentralized economies. Focusing on user experience, reducing technical barriers, and creating cross-platform interaction will help make Web3 games more appealing to a broader audience.

Key Points Details
Gaming Industry Challenges The industry is facing declines with major studio closures and layoffs, driven by high development costs and an innovation crisis.
Web3 Gaming Promise Web3 was seen as a potential solution to empower developers and offer new funding avenues while addressing traditional gaming issues.
Failure to Capture Mainstream Attention Despite crypto adoption, Web3 gaming hasn’t attracted mainstream players or resolved core gaming challenges, leading to isolated ecosystems.
High Acquisition Costs Web3 platforms face high player acquisition costs and suffer from a limited gamer base unfamiliar with crypto mechanics.
Redundant Systems Early platforms have recreated enclosed systems, restricting player migration instead of fulfilling the promises of blockchain.
Need for Innovative Infrastructure There is a lack of gaming-focused infrastructures in Web3, hindering development and the ability to engage mainstream audiences.
Focus on Gameplay and Fun Moving forward requires a return to the fundamentals of enjoyable gaming rather than solely focusing on tokenomics.
